Post by: Chase on April 17, 2016, 02:08:36 pm
I made spells in back in Cataclysm. Should be possible if you fill out all the dbc's that are linked starting from Spell.dbc. Also, SpellEffect.dbc which people miss because its not directly linked.

The problem is not all of the WoD dbc's are documented because people insist on staying on a 8 year old version of the game.
